STA310
Downsampling filter
Address: 0x70
Type: R/W
Software Reset: NC
Hardware Reset: UND
Description:
This register controls the downsampling filter for the
LPCM video, LPCM audio modes. When decoding a
96kHz DVD-LPCM stream, it might be necessary to
downsample the stream to 48kHz .

VOLUME0
Volume of first channel
Address: 0x4E
Type: RWS
Software Reset: 0
Hardware Reset: UND
Description:
This register reads or writes the attenuation that is
applied to the channel selected by CHAN_IDX. The
volume of the left channel can be set up with a 0.5dB
step.

If CHAN_IDX = 0, then VOLUME0 can be
written with the attenuation that will be applied
to Left channel.
If CHAN_IDX = 1, then VOLUME0 can be
written with the attenuation that will be applied
to Center channel.

VOLUME1
Volume of second channel
Address: 0x63
Type: RWS
Software Reset: 0
Hardware Reset: UND
Description:
This register reads or writes the attenuation that is
applied to the channel selected by CHAN_IDX. The
volume of the right channel can be set up with a
0.5dB step.
If CHAN_IDX = 2, then VOLUME0 can be
written with the attenuation that will be applied
to Left Surround channel.
If CHAN_IDX = 5, then reading VOLUME0
provides the attenuation that is applied to Left
channel.
If CHAN_IDX = 6, then reading VOLUME0
provides the attenuation that is applied to
Center channel.
If CHAN_IDX = 7, then reading VOLUME0
provides the attenuation that is applied to Left
Surround channel.
Other values of CHAN_IDX are reserved.
If CHAN_IDX = 0, then VOLUME1 can be
written with the attenuation that will be applied
to Right channel.
If CHAN_IDX = 1, then VOLUME1 can be
written with the attenuation that will be applied
to Subwoofer channel.
If CHAN_IDX = 2, then VOLUME1 can be
written with the attenuation that will be applied
to Right Surround channel.
If CHAN_IDX = 5, then reading VOLUME1
provides the attenuation that is applied to Right
channel.
If CHAN_IDX = 6, then reading VOLUME1
provides the attenuation that is applied to
Subwoofer channel.
If CHAN_IDX = 7, then reading VOLUME1
provides the attenuation that is applied to Right
Surround channel.
Other values of CHAN_IDX are reserved.
